在Access数据库中,合理设置字段大小对于确保数据完整性和避免数据丢失至关重要。本文将详细介绍如何根据不同的数据类型和需求来设置字段大小,帮助您轻松掌握Access数据库字段大小设置的全攻略。
字段大小设置的重要性
在Access数据库中,每个字段都有其最大存储容量。如果超出这个容量,数据可能会丢失或损坏。因此,正确设置字段大小是保证数据库稳定运行的关键。
字段类型与大小
Access数据库支持多种数据类型,每种类型都有其特定的字段大小限制。以下是一些常见的数据类型及其字段大小:
- 文本(Text):最大长度为255个字符。
- 备注(Memo):最大长度为65535个字符。
- 数字(Number):根据数字类型的不同,长度和精度也有所不同。
- 日期/时间(Date/Time):固定长度,8个字节。
- 货币(Currency):固定长度,8个字节。
- 自动编号(AutoNumber):固定长度,4个字节。
- 是/否(Yes/No):固定长度,1个字节。
- OLE对象(OLE Object):最大长度为1GB。
- 超级链接(Hyperlink):最大长度为255个字符。
- 附件(Attachment):最大长度为1GB。
设置字段大小
1. 使用设计视图
在Access中,您可以通过设计视图来设置字段大小。以下是具体步骤:
- 打开数据库,选择要修改的字段所在的表。
- 单击“设计”选项卡。
- 在“字段”列中,找到要修改的字段。
- 在“数据类型”列中,选择合适的字段类型。
- 根据需要调整字段大小。
2. 使用代码设置字段大小
如果您需要通过代码来设置字段大小,可以使用以下VBA代码:
' 假设要设置名为 "MyField" 的字段大小
Me.MyField.Size = 50
3. 注意事项
- 在设置字段大小时,请确保不超过该数据类型的最大长度。
- 如果您需要存储超过最大长度的数据,请考虑使用其他数据类型,如“备注”或“OLE对象”。
- 在修改字段大小后,请确保所有相关表和查询都已更新。
总结
通过本文的介绍,相信您已经掌握了Access数据库字段大小设置的全攻略。合理设置字段大小,可以有效避免数据丢失,确保数据库的稳定运行。在操作过程中,请务必注意数据类型和字段大小的匹配,以确保数据的完整性和准确性。
